Factors Affecting Outcomes of Using Diode Laser Both 980 nm Wave Length and 450 Wavelength on Benign Laryngeal Lesions in Comparison to Traditional Cold Instrumentations as Regard Parameters of Laser Device, Nature of Lesion and Patient Factors

Brief Summary

Studying the different Factors affecting the outcomes of using diode laser both 980 nm wave length and 450 wavelength on benign laryngeal lesions in comparison to traditional cold instrumentations

Primary Outcome Measures
NameTimeMethod
change in voice handicap index Arabic version (VHI-Arabic)2 months after treatment

change in Voice handicap index Arabic version from baseline before treatment and after treatment

change in voice acoustic analysis2 months after treatment

change in voice acoustic analysis including change in jitter and shimmer values from baseline preoperative and 2 months after treatment

change in modified grade of dysphonia, roughness, breathness and asthenia score ( modified GRBAS)2 months after treatment

change in modified grade of dysphonia, roughness, breathness and asthenia score ( modified GRBAS) from baseline preoperative and 2 months after treatment
